Where Most Financial Advisors Drop the Ball | Chris Casey

You Asked, Chris Casey Answers… How often should your financial advisor actually be calling you? Chris Casey joins Maggie Lake to break down the four factors that determine communication frequency: client preference, portfolio complexity, market conditions, and investment activity. He explains where most advisors drop the ball, why picking up the phone is a lost skill, and what clients can do to get more value from every interaction. If you've ever wondered whether your advisor is doing enough, this short conversation gives you the questions to ask and the expectations to set.
